These guys have an unfortunate band name. They sound nothing like a Grinderswitch. Grinderswitch makes me think of a brooding, leatherclad death metal band, complete with a drummer with three bass pedals. These guys sound more like a Steely Dan type jam band if anything.
And according to their bio, they were originally formed in the 70s, so the classic/southern rock feel has its merits. They’ve toured with The Allman Bros Band, The Marshall tucker Band, The Charlie Daniels Band, Wet Willie and Lynyrd Skynrd. When Disco arrived the group eventually disbanded, but have recently reunited to play their old songs as well as new material. Good to see a band survive longer than Disco did!
